Gravel biking around Heming offers a network of no traffic routes characterized by varied terrain and natural landscapes. The region features a mix of forests, valleys, and waterways, providing diverse environments for cycling. Elevations are generally moderate, with some routes including gradual climbs. The area is suitable for exploring on gravel bikes due to its blend of packed dirt paths and less technical trails.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many traffic-free gravel bike trails are available around Heming?

There are 8 traffic-free gravel bike trails documented around Heming, offering a variety of experiences for cyclists looking to avoid busy roads. Most of these routes are rated as moderate, with one challenging option for more experienced riders.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the gravel bike trails near Heming?

The gravel bike trails around Heming feature diverse terrain. While some sections might be smoother, you can expect a mix of packed dirt, gravel, and potentially some chunkier surfaces with roots or rocks, especially on more challenging routes. This variety demands a delicate approach and proper riding techniques.

Are there any easy or beginner-friendly traffic-free gravel routes in Heming?

While all routes are categorized as 'mtb_easy' in terms of sport, their difficulty grades are predominantly 'moderate'. This suggests they are accessible but might require a reasonable level of fitness. For a moderate ride, consider the Kanalbrücke über dem Saartal loop from Sarrebourg, which covers 28.3 km with a modest elevation gain.

What are some of the longer traffic-free gravel bike routes around Heming?

For those seeking a longer ride, the Reservoir on the old canal – The Valley of the Lock Keepers loop from Hertzing is a great option, spanning approximately 54.3 km. Another substantial route is the Étang des Souches – The three bridges loop from Rhodes, which is about 41.3 km long.

What attractions or points of interest can I see along the traffic-free gravel trails?

The routes around Heming offer scenic views and interesting landmarks. You can explore beautiful lakes such as Étang du Stock Dam and Magnificent view of the Stock pond. Many trails also follow or cross significant waterways like the Canal de la Marne au Rhin Cycle Path and feature impressive structures like The Great Lock of Réchicourt.

Are there any circular gravel bike routes available near Heming?

Yes, all the listed traffic-free gravel bike routes around Heming are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. Examples include the Center Park The Three Forests – Fairies' Rock loop from Bertrambois and the Center Park The Three Forests – Fairies' Rock loop from Hattigny.

What do other gravel bikers say about the trails in Heming?

The komoot community rates the traffic-free bike rides around Heming highly, with an average score of 4.33 out of 5 stars. Users often praise the quiet, natural surroundings and the varied terrain that makes for an engaging ride away from vehicle traffic.

What is the elevation gain like on the gravel bike trails around Heming?

The elevation gains on these routes vary, catering to different fitness levels. For instance, the Étang des Souches – The three bridges loop from Rhodes has around 223 meters of ascent, while the Center Park The Three Forests – Fairies' Rock loop from Bertrambois features over 423 meters of climbing, offering more challenging options.

Are there any specific highlights related to cycling infrastructure in the Heming area?

Yes, the region features notable cycling infrastructure, including sections of the EuroVelo 5: Gondrexange Ponds and Blanche Chaussée Ponds and the Canal de la Marne au Rhin Cycle Path, which provide excellent traffic-free surfaces for gravel biking.
